Is Tata Salt iodized?

The pioneer of salt iodisation in India, Tata Salt, holds the distinction of being India’s first national branded iodised salt. Using Vacuum® Evaporation technology, Tata Salt offered consumers a healthy, hygienic alternative — an iodised vacuum evaporated salt that was untouched by hand.

Who makes Tata Salt?

Tata Chemicals
Tata Salt was launched in 1983 by Tata Chemicals as India’s first packaged iodised salt brand. The brand is now the biggest packaged salt brand in India, with a market share of 17\%.

Why does salt become blue?

What we get as common salt is not lab grade pure NaCl,it is iodized. Lemon juice somehow releases the iodine from the salt. The colour of iodine is purple. That’s why it turns purple or a bluish colour.

Why is the price of salt going up?

As county governments and private snow removal companies are ordering more salt, hoping to be better prepared for the coming winter, it drives the cost of salt up as demand increases. Experts explain that logistics, price bidding and supply challenges are contributing to the increase in salt prices.
